In this article – “Tax planning developments: Important international tax changes” – we review such factors as the proposed changes for international taxation in Canada in 2021; Canada’s continuing work with the OECD, G20 and a number of other countries on significant international tax reform proposals; proposed new limits on interest deductibility; proposed anti-hybrid measures designed to reduce the tax advantages currently available in some situations as a result of an entity being treated differently by different jurisdictions; a proposed digital services tax on digital services that rely on the engagement, data and content contributions of Canadian users; an international tax reform proposal that provides new taxing rights for market jurisdictions to obtain a share of residual profit of a multinational enterprise; and an International Framework agreement that involves a proposed global minimum tax.

This article is authored by Patrick Marley, partner and co-chair, Osler’s Tax Group, and Ilana Ludwin, associate, Tax Group.
